
Selecting the right outsourcing firm for your management accounting needs is a critical decision. It can significantly impact your business’s financial health and operational efficiency. A key factor in this selection process is technological integration in accounting. This ensures the firm can seamlessly integrate with your existing software and systems for smooth operations and data consistency.
In today’s digital age, businesses rely on various software applications to manage operations. These include enterprise resource planning (ERP) systems and customer relationship management (CRM) tools. When outsourcing management accounts, it’s essential that the chosen firm can work harmoniously with these existing systems. Effective integration offers several benefits:
Ensures that financial data is accurate and up-to-date across all platforms, reducing errors and discrepancies.
Streamlines workflows by allowing seamless data flow between systems, saving time and reducing manual input.
Facilitates easy adaptation to new technologies or system upgrades, supporting business growth and evolution.
To ensure effective technological integration, consider the following factors when selecting an outsourced accounting firm:
Assess the firm’s proficiency with your current software and their ability to integrate with various platforms. A firm experienced in accounting software integration can provide a seamless transition and ongoing support.
Determine whether the firm can tailor their services to align with your specific operational needs and existing systems. This flexibility ensures that the outsourced services complement your business processes.
Ensure the firm employs robust security protocols to protect sensitive financial information during integration and daily operations. Data breaches can have severe consequences, making security a paramount concern.
Evaluate the firm’s commitment to ongoing communication and support, particularly during the integration phase. Responsive support can address issues promptly, minimizing disruptions.
Request references or case studies demonstrating the firm’s successful integration with other clients’ systems. This evidence can provide insight into their capabilities and reliability.
